Top 5 Mature Hyperledger Projects for Enterprise Blockchain Solutions

ยท

Hyperledger, hosted by the Linux Foundation, stands at the forefront of enterprise blockchain adoption. Its open-source projects provide robust, modular frameworks designed for various business use cases, from supply chain management to digital identity. This article explores five mature Hyperledger distributed ledger technologies (DLTs) that are actively shaping the future of enterprise blockchain solutions.

What Is Hyperledger?

Hyperledger is a global collaborative effort aimed at advancing cross-industry blockchain technologies. It offers a suite of stable frameworks, tools, and libraries for building enterprise-grade blockchain applications. Unlike public blockchains, Hyperledger projects are permissioned, meaning participants are known and trusted, which enhances privacy, security, and scalability.

Hyperledger Fabric

Hyperledger Fabric is one of the most widely adopted Hyperledger frameworks. It allows organizations to build scalable, secure distributed ledger networks. Fabric's modular architecture supports pluggable components for consensus and membership services, making it highly adaptable.

Key features of Hyperledger Fabric include:

Fabric is particularly well-suited for supply chain management, financial services, and healthcare applications due to its flexibility and granular access controls.

Hyperledger Besu

Hyperledger Besu is an open-source Ethereum client designed for both public and private networks. It complies with the Enterprise Ethereum Alliance (EEA) specifications, ensuring interoperability and avoiding vendor lock-in.

Notable aspects of Hyperledger Besu:

Besu is ideal for organizations looking to leverage Ethereum's ecosystem while maintaining the control and privacy of a permissioned network.

Hyperledger Sawtooth

Hyperledger Sawtooth emphasizes performance and simplicity. Its unique architecture separates the core system from application logic, simplifying development and deployment.

Highlights of Hyperledger Sawtooth:

Sawtooth is excellent for high-throughput applications like IoT data processing or financial trading platforms.

Hyperledger Iroha

Hyperledger Iroha focuses on managing digital assets and identities with an emphasis on user-friendliness. Written in C++, it offers a straightforward approach to blockchain integration.

Key capabilities of Hyperledger Iroha:

Iroha is well-suited for applications in healthcare, education, and digital identity management where ease of use and security are critical.

Hyperledger Indy

Hyperledger Indy is specialized for decentralized identity management. It provides tools for creating and managing self-sovereign identities (SSI), ensuring privacy and interoperability across domains.

Standout features of Hyperledger Indy:

Indy is perfect for projects requiring secure, privacy-preserving identity solutions, such as citizen services or credential verification.

Frequently Asked Questions

What is the main difference between Hyperledger and Ethereum?
Hyperledger is designed for permissioned enterprise networks where participants are known, offering enhanced privacy and scalability. Ethereum is primarily a public blockchain supporting permissionless participation, though it can be adapted for private use with tools like Hyperledger Besu.

Which Hyperledger project is best for supply chain management?
Hyperledger Fabric is widely used in supply chain solutions due to its support for multi-ledger setups and private data exchanges. However, Hyperledger Grid, a specialized toolset, also offers supply chain-specific capabilities.

Can Hyperledger Besu be used on public Ethereum networks?
Yes, Hyperledger Besu functions as a full Ethereum client, compatible with public mainnets and testnets like Rinkeby and Ropsten, while also supporting private consortium networks.

How does Hyperledger Indy protect user privacy?
Indy uses zero-knowledge proofs and decentralized identifiers to allow users to share minimal, verified information without revealing underlying data, ensuring privacy and reducing fraud risk.

Is Hyperledger Sawtooth suitable for high-performance applications?
Absolutely. Sawtooth's parallel transaction execution and modular design make it ideal for high-throughput use cases such as IoT systems or real-time data processing.

What consensus mechanisms does Hyperledger support?
Hyperledger projects support various consensus algorithms, including Practical Byzantine Fault Tolerance (PBFT), Proof of Authority (PoA), and Raft, allowing organizations to choose based on their security and performance needs.

Conclusion

Hyperledger offers a diverse range of mature projects tailored to different enterprise needs. Fabric excels in modularity and privacy, Besu bridges Ethereum's ecosystem with enterprise requirements, Sawtooth delivers high performance, Iroha simplifies asset management, and Indy specializes in decentralized identity. By understanding each project's strengths, organizations can select the right framework to build scalable, secure blockchain solutions. For those exploring implementation, ๐Ÿ‘‰ explore more strategies for enterprise blockchain integration to enhance your project's success.